Ongoing Efforts to Ensure Accessibility
We follow the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) version 2.1 as our guiding principle for determining accessibility. These are internationally agreed-upon standards that cover a wide range of recommendations and best practices for making content useable. As we add new pages and functionality to our website, all designs, code, and content entry practices are checked against these standards.
Website accessibility is an ongoing process. We continually test content and features for WCAG 2.1 Level AA compliance and remediate any issues to ensure we meet or exceed the standards. Testing of our website is performed by our team members using industry-standard tools such as the Accessibility Checker WordPress Plugin, color contrast analyzers, keyboard-only navigation techniques, and Flesch-Kincaid readability tests.
Accessibility Features On Our Website
The following is a list of items we have included in our website to improve its accessibility:
- Semantic HTML: We have structured the website content logically with informative headings, labels, and ARIA attributes to facilitate easy comprehension by screen readers and assistive technologies.
- Alternative Text: We have added descriptive alternative text for all images and non-text content to enable accessibility with screen readers and assistive technologies.
- Keyboard Navigation: Our website can be efficiently navigated using a keyboard or voice recognition, eliminating the need for a mouse.
- Readable Text: We use legible fonts, readable text sizes, and appropriate color contrasts to ensure content is easily readable
- Consistent Layout: Our website maintains a consistent and predictable layout to simplify navigation
- Accessible Forms: Online forms on our website are designed with accessibility in mind, including clear field labels and error notifications.
- Streamlined Interface: We have optimized our web pages by consolidating sections, removing redundant content, and prioritizing concise, user-friendly content for an improved user experience.
- Responsive Design: Our website design has a mobile-responsive version with appropriately sized tap-targets.
- Navigational Aids: Skip navigation links have been incorporated to facilitate keyboard navigation and to bypass content on a page, allowing users to jump directly to the primary navigation, main content, and footer.
- Language: Our website declares a language in the header.
- ARIA: Accessible Rich Internet Applications (ARIA) screen-reader only text is present when links, buttons, icons, or images require additional context to understand their meaning.
